DURHAM -- Brianna Gomez and
Hanna Giddings stayed unbeaten in singles matches, helping UNCG stay perfect in women's tennis with a 6-1 victory at N.C. Central in a non-conference match Wednesday afternoon.
The Spartans are 4-0 and off to their best start in at least 15 years while dropping Central to 1-6. The Spartans next host Wofford in a Southern Conference match at 1 p.m. Saturday.
Gomez defeated Central's Josefa Fernandez 0-6, 6-4, 6-1 at first singles, while Giddings beat Maru Berghaus in straight sets at second singles, 6-3, 6-3.
Eugenia Camacho,
Juliana Craft and
Tayah Cross also won singles matches for The G, which improved to 19-5 in singles matches so far this season.
UNCG scored its first doubles point of the season. Giddings and Cross won their match 6-2, while Camacho and Gomez won a walkover at third doubles.
Jade Houston scored Central's lone point, defeating UNCG's
Emily Ory at third singles 4-6, 7-6 (7-1), 6-1.
